as posted by the channelIn this episode, we explore the intricate dynamics between men expressing emotions and the subsequent reactions from women, often resulting in discomfort or loss of attraction. Reflecting on personal experiences, the conversation delves into societal expectations from the Red Pill and Mens communities to modern therapy-influenced norms. The hosts analyze the cultural and biological differences that shape how men and women process and express emotions, questioning the authenticity and nature of prescribed emotional vulnerability. They also discuss the implications of these norms on relationships, touching on historical and modern examples, and consider whether younger generations might have differing desires for emotional expression and leadership roles in relationships. The episode ends with a brief mention of their personal projects and creative endeavors.
